Farm 2 School Webinar #2: Partnering with Cooperative Extension to Support Farm to School

Webinar #2: Partnering with Cooperative Extension to Support Farm to School Wednesday, October 9, 2013 | 1 p.m. – 2 p.m. EST

Presenters: Julia Govis, Program Coordinator, University of Illinois Extension and Morgan Taggart, Program Specialist, Ohio State University Extension

Julia Govis from University of Illinois Extension will share information about how she is leading farm to school in Illinois through the development of educational resources and curriculum to support Extension work in its diverse program areas. Morgan Taggart from Ohio State University Extension will describe how OSU Extension has prioritized involvement in farm to school and how other Extension professionals in urban and suburban areas can be involved with farm to school related activities. Morgan will also share how she is currently involved with farm to school across the Cleveland area through school gardens, local food procurement, and local food and agriculture curriculum development/ instruction.

This webinar is part of two webinar series in partnership with the USDA Farm to School Program and the eXtension Community of Practice in Community, Local, and Regional Food Systems.

About the Extension Foundation

The Extension Foundation was formed in 2006 by Extension Directors and Administrators. Today, the Foundation partners with Cooperative Extension through liaison roles and a formal plan of work with the Extension Committee on Organization and Policy (ECOP) to increase system capacity while providing programmatic services, and helping Extension programs scale and investigate new methods and models for implementing programs. The Foundation provides professional development to Cooperative Extension professionals and offers exclusive services to its members. In 2020 and 2021, the Extension Foundation has awarded 85% of its direct funding back to the Cooperative Extension System, 100% of funds are used to support Cooperative Extension initiatives.
